Output 3d49de3c21c14941143cd332b3c9065c3f0eb4f66b74741acd3e20b9552f30fa:2

value
393294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3f4bd6e62e0b999ca4ede2fba1fffc12c71be97 OP_EQUAL
address
3GdwFeFRzjckdTHD6eCpDr4Bn8oNsnBGSy
transaction
3d49de3c21c14941143cd332b3c9065c3f0eb4f66b74741acd3e20b9552f30fa
confirmations
181996
spent
true